About the Role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a proactive and highly organised Services Manager to join a successful and respected department at one of London’s leading independent day schools.
This pivotal role involves overseeing the daily operations, safety, and presentation of UCS facilities across all Foundation sites. The successful candidate will ensure our school environment is clean, safe, well-maintained, and conducive to learning.
You will be responsible for managing internal teams (including caretaking, security, and maintenance) as well as liaising with and overseeing external service providers. You’ll work closely with colleagues across departments to deliver a high standard of facilities support throughout the school year.
This is an excellent opportunity for someone with strong leadership skills and a hands-on approach who is looking to make a tangible difference in a values-driven school environment.

Safeguarding and Recruitment Checks
University College School is fully committ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. The successful applicant will be required to undertake an En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check for Regulated Activity. We will also conduct a full range of recruitment checks, including references and verification of identity and employment history, in line with safer recruitment practices.
